A novel nitrogen-doped Nb2O5 (N-Nb2O5) nanobelt quasi-arrays has been simply prepared by traditional hydrothermal reaction and followed by annealing in NH3 atmosphere on metal Nb foil. Adjusting the annealing temperature can alternate the amount of N doped. The as-prepared N-Nb2O5 nanobelt shows strong sensitivity to visible light and performs excellent photocatalysis activity. The contaminant in the water can be dissolved up to 40% after 4 h visible light irradiation. The N-Nb2O5 nanobelt photocatalyst will be a promising candidate for future water contaminant treatment.
